Forklifts
In material handling, construction, warehousing and manufacturing operation, forklifts are usually utilized to transport and raise palletized loads. With manual-drive forklifts, the load or travel movement is either powered manually or walk-behind. Motorized drive forklifts have a motorized drive. In various kinds of forklifts, the forklift has a protected cab or seat for the operator. Fork trucks include features such as backup alarms, and cabs and are also motorized. Some types of forklifts are counterbalanced in order to prevent the vehicle from tipping over. Other types of forklifts are offered with safety rails, or a rotating element like a turntable or a hand rail.

Other specifications which are vital to consider when selecting a forklift are the stroke and lift capacity. Lift capacity is defined as the maximum, supportable load or force. Stroke is defined as the difference between completely lowered and completely raised lift positions.

Several of the other important specifications for the forklift are tire type and fuel type. The fuel choices available include: liquid propane or LP, natural gas, electricity, CNG or compressed natural gas, gasoline, propane or diesel.

There are two basic types of tires used for forklifts and fork trucks: solid and pneumatic. The cushion or solid tires need less maintenance than pneumatic tires and do not easily puncture. Air-inflated or pneumatic tires offer load cushioning and great drive traction. At the end of the day, cushion or solid tires provide less shock absorption.
